The hexadecimal color code #0B221A corresponds to the code RGB( 11, 34, 26 ). It's a shade of Black. This color is a combination of red (at 0,04 level), green (at 0,13 level) and blue (at 0,10 level). Its brightness is 8% and its saturation is 51%. It is composed of red at 15%, green at 47% and blue at 36%.
